Being responsible for magical women isn’t just a duty, it’s a pleasure.

Earth might not have magic, but it does have the PlanesWatcher. Born with the power to open portals to other realms, Derrick is chosen by a deity to wage a secret war against an ancient force of entropy. To keep the last remaining worlds safe, he chooses to help a party of beautiful champions empowered by the goddess herself.

But when the realms are suddenly invaded, Derrick must travel between dimensions to find and strengthen the women he’s chosen to protect…using a method only a goddess with a one-track mind could bestow.

Leveling up has never felt better, but will it be enough to prevent the end of all things?
